Civic Initiative

Civic Initiative is a registered charity in Northern Ireland working in the advancement of education, the advancement of citizenship or community development, the advancement of human rights, based in Fivemiletown.

Quick answer

Civic Initiative is a registered charity (number NIC110832) on the Charity Commission for Northern Ireland (CCNI) register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: the advancement of education; the advancement of citizenship or community development; the advancement of human rights. What does Civic Initiative do?

To act as a vehicle for enhancing Civic voice with the purpose of advancing community development, social cohesion, conflict resolution, and active citizenship

How do I check charity number NIC110832?
Search NIC110832 on the Charity Commission for Northern Ireland (CCNI) register or on CharityCompare. Confirm the registered name matches the organisation asking for money — scammers sometimes reuse real charity numbers.
